We just have a small garden for the 2 of us, but it produces above
average yields You will notice we use wheat straw for top mulch &
there is a reason. We could not control white flies until Walter
Reeves suggested the wheat straw. The straw is home to hundreds of
spiders that eat every white fly before they have wings!!

For those of you that have never heard of Walter Reeves, he is retired
from the University of Georgia Cooperative Extension Service. His
website is extensive!!
http://walterreeves.com/


I have the same results with alfalfa. When I wet it down, there is a
mass exodus of spiders.
